Understanding The Meaning of WYF
The Basics: What Does WYF Mean on Instagram?
In most contexts, WYF stands for "What's Your Favorite?" It's commonly used on Instagram within captions, comments, or stories to prompt responses about preferences. Whether users are discussing movies, travel destinations, or dining experiences, WYF serves as a way to engage followers in sharing their favorites.
This abbreviation simplifies broad questions into a concise format, making it ideal for the fast-paced social media environment. It invites interaction and engagement, which are key metrics for social media success.

The Importance of Context When Interpreting WYF
Nuanced Applications
While WYF predominantly stands for "What's Your Favorite?", context is key to interpreting any slang accurately. Variations of WYF can have differentiated meanings based on users' intent or specific subcultures on Instagram. Occasionally, users may utilize WYF in a different context, intending to ask “Where You From?” especially when initiating personal connections.
To accurately decipher WYF's intended meaning, consider the accompanying text, images, or hashtags. Instagram’s visual nature often provides clues to the conversation's context, and exploring comments can help clarify uncertainties.
Potential Misinterpretations
Misunderstanding social media slang can lead to confusion or missed opportunities for effective interaction. Although less common, if someone uses WYF meaning “Where You From?” in a greeting or introduction, responding with your location instead of your favorite item maintains the conversation’s fluidity.

Comparisons with Other Social Media Slang
WYF vs. AMA (Ask Me Anything)
While both WYF and AMA engage followers, they serve slightly different purposes. AMA often opens the floor to any inquiries about the user's life or experiences, while WYF targets specific favorites, focusing the interaction and potentially offering richer content on niche topics.
WYF and TBT (Throwback Thursday)
Although unrelated in meaning, both WYF and TBT stimulate memory-driven responses. TBT capitalizes on nostalgia, showcasing past experiences, while WYF encourages discussing current preferences, possibly influenced by nostalgic choices.
